Ukraine says it shot down nine Russian drones out of 14 launched overnight. Most of the Iranian-made Shahed drones targeted "energy infrastructure" in the central Dnipro region.

The power outages mainly affected Kryvyi Rig, the hometown of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ky. The head of the city's military administration, Oleksandr Vilkul, indicated for his part that energy companies would "introduce emergency cut-off times" Ukraine's Energy Ministry said it was working to restore critical infrastructure.
